Diamond planning is an intricate process that transforms raw gems into brilliant masterpieces, guided by advanced technology and expert knowledge. The journey begins with a 360-degree X-ray scan using the Galaxy machine, capturing a detailed image of the diamond’s internal structure. This high-tech imaging helps in assessing the diamond’s potential and pinpointing areas for optimal cutting.
the diamond undergoes meticulous sorting and marking to define the best possible cuts. Utilizing the Sarin Advisor program, planners compare the diamond against numerous other plans, with the Rappaport pricing benchmark serving as a critical reference. This ensures that every decision aligns with industry standards and maximizes the diamond’s value.

Very Crucial Stage For Profit
The planning phase involves intensive decision-making, focusing on the diamond’s 4Cs—cut, color, clarity, and carat weight. Each decision impacts the final price and overall market appeal, making precise planning essential. Frequent reviews and adjustments ensure that the final plan not only enhances the diamond’s beauty but also achieves the highest market value.
